Abstract
The Szilard–Chalmers recoil of the cations La3+, Ba2+, Co2+, Zn2+, Cu2+, Cs+, Rb+, K+, Na+ and Ag+ located in the supercage sites of zeolites X and Y has been studied. After irradiation with thermal neutrons ∼90 % of the recoiling cations are found in the supercage sites with La3+, Ag+ and Na+ being the only exceptions. The figure of 90 % has been shown to be independent of the character of the cation located in the sodalite cages and hexagonal prisms of these faujasite type zeolites and also independent of the charge density of the framework.Keywords
